Researchers have developed a new artificial skin that may be more touch-sensitive than human hands. by patient-Spring-4 in Futurology

[–]patient-Spring-4[S] 7 points8 points  (0 children)

"Essentially, the skin consists of two thin, flexible fabric electrodes sandwiched around a layer of spongy material soaked in ion-sensitive liquid. This stack of materials acts as a capacitor — meaning it can pick up on changes in pressure or differences in charge between electrodes with extreme sensitivity.
In fact, the faux skin is so sensitive that it can tell when it’s near an object without actually touching it — its porous ion layer has the shark-like ability to catch the subtle disruptions to its electric field caused by nearby objects."
